Abstract

The utility model discloses a desk lamp capable of automatically adjusting the irradiation angle, belonging to the technical field of desk lamp illumination, comprising a base, a second bevel gear, a shell, a thread bush, a first adjusting rod, a lamp post and a rubber buffer cushion, wherein a cavity is arranged in the base, a second rotating shaft is arranged in the middle of the cavity, and a turntable is arranged above the second rotating shaft; the rotary table is provided with a shell, and the screw rod is sleeved with a threaded sleeve; the lamp post is installed to the one side that first rotation seat was kept away from to the second regulation pole. The utility model discloses a cooperation that second motor, lead screw, first rotation seat, first regulation pole, second regulation pole, buffer spring, second rotation seat, lamp pole and the third that set up was rotated between the seat is used, can make the bulb rotate the seat around the third in vertical direction and rotate to the realization is to the regulation of the angle in the vertical direction of bulb.

Detailed Description
The technical solution of the present patent will be described in further detail with reference to the following embodiments.
Referring to fig. 1-5, a desk lamp capable of automatically adjusting an illumination angle includes a base 1, a second bevel gear 8, a housing 11, a threaded sleeve 18, a first adjusting rod 23, a lamp post 27, and a rubber cushion 32; a cavity 2 is arranged in the base 1, a first motor 3 is arranged on the inner wall of the left side of the cavity 2, a first rotating shaft 4 is arranged on the right side of the first motor 3, a first bevel gear 5 is arranged on the right side of the first rotating shaft 4, a second rotating shaft 6 is arranged in the middle of the cavity 2, a shaft sleeve 7 is connected between the second rotating shaft 6 and the base 1, the upper part of the second rotating shaft 6 extends to the upper part of the base 1, a second bevel gear 8 is arranged on the second rotating shaft 6, the second bevel gear 8 is positioned in the cavity 2, the first bevel gear 5 and the second bevel gear 8 are connected in a meshing manner, a rotating disc 9 is arranged above the second rotating shaft 6, two supporting rods 10 are symmetrically arranged on the left side and the right side below the rotating disc 9, a sliding block 11 is arranged below the supporting rods 10, a ring-shaped sliding groove 12 is arranged above the base 1, the sliding block 11 is arranged in the ring-shaped sliding groove 12, and the supporting rods 10, the sliding block 11 and the ring-shaped sliding groove 12 are matched, the turntable 9 can be rotated more stably.
Install casing 13 on carousel 9, adopt fastening screw fixed connection between carousel 9 and the casing 13, the left side of casing 13 is provided with regulation mouth 17, be provided with fixed plate 16 in the middle of the right side inner wall of casing 13, right side inner wall below of casing 13 is provided with guide way 19, second motor 14 is installed to the inside below of casing 1, lead screw 15 is installed to the top of second motor 14, the top of lead screw 15 is connected to fixed plate 16, threaded sleeve 18 has been cup jointed on the lead screw 15, guide bar 20 is installed on the right side of threaded sleeve 18, guide block 21 is installed to one side that threaded sleeve 18 was kept away from to guide bar 20, guide block 21 sets up in guide way 19, can drive lead screw 15 through second motor 14 and rotate, lead screw 15 can drive threaded sleeve 18 and reciprocate along lead screw 15, first motor 3 and second motor 14 are controlled through external controller.
A first rotating seat 22 is installed on one side of the threaded sleeve 18 far away from the guide rod 20, a first adjusting rod 23 is installed on the first rotating seat 22, an installation groove 24 is formed on one side of the first adjusting rod 23 far away from the first rotating seat 22, a second adjusting rod 25 is installed on the installation groove 24, a lamp post 27 is installed on one side of the second adjusting rod 25 far away from the first adjusting rod 23, a second rotating seat 29 is installed between the lamp post 27 and the second adjusting rod 25, a third rotating seat 26 is installed between the right side of the lamp post 27 and the inner wall of the right side of the shell 13, a bulb 28 is installed on the left side of the lamp post 27, a buffer spring 30 is installed between the first adjusting rod 23 and the second rotating seat 29, the buffer spring 30 is sleeved on the second adjusting rod 25, the buffer spring 30 can buffer the thrust generated by the vertical movement of the first adjusting rod 23, and prevent the damage of the lamp post 27 caused by the excessive vertical movement thrust of the first adjusting rod 23.
The below of base 1 is provided with dovetail 31, and rubber buffer 32 is installed to the below of dovetail 31, can cushion the vibrations that first motor 3 and second motor 14 during operation produced through setting up rubber buffer 32, reduces the noise that vibrations produced, plays the effect of amortization noise reduction, and the below equipartition of rubber buffer 32 is provided with a plurality of sucking discs 33, and the sucking disc 33 through setting up can make base 1 place more stably.
The utility model discloses a theory of operation is: the first motor 3 is controlled to rotate through the external controller, the first motor 3 drives the first rotating shaft 4 to rotate, the first rotating shaft 4 drives the first bevel gear 5 to rotate, the first bevel gear 5 drives the second bevel gear 8 to rotate, the second bevel gear 8 drives the second rotating shaft 6 to rotate, the second rotating shaft 6 drives the rotating disc 9 to rotate, the rotating disc 9 drives the shell 13 to rotate, the shell 13 drives the lamp post 27 to rotate, and the lamp post 27 drives the lamp bulb 28 to rotate, so that the angle of the lamp bulb 28 in the horizontal direction is adjusted; the screw rod 15 is driven to rotate by the counterclockwise or clockwise rotation of the second motor 14, the screw rod 15 drives the thread bush 18 to move up and down along the screw rod 15, the screw rod 15 drives the first adjusting rod 23 to move through the first rotating seat 22, the first adjusting rod 23 drives the lamp post 27 to rotate counterclockwise or clockwise around the second rotating seat 26 under the action of the second adjusting rod 25 and the buffer spring 30, and therefore the lamp post 27 drives the bulb 28 to adjust the angle in the vertical direction.
